An increase in yearly benefits of 1,000 euros is estimated to increase the incidence of single mother families by about 2 percent. Marriage provides positive impacts well beyond self-sufficiency, but the positive effects of marriage are not limited to self-sufficiency. Children raised by married parents have substantially better life outcomes compared with similar children raised in single-parent homes.
